Freigeben über


Bearbeiten der XML-Datei für Anpassungen mit Schemaüberprüfung

Die Datei customizations.xml ist in der komprimierten ZIP-Datei enthalten, die als Lösung exportiert wird. Bestimmte Teile der Datei customizations.xml können manuell bearbeitet werden. Informationen zum Schema helfen dabei, sicherzustellen, dass alle Änderungen, die Sie vornehmen, gültig sind.

XSD-Schemadateien:

Downloaden Sie die Schemas für die XSD-Schemadateien, die zur Validierung der Datei customization.xml in einer Lösung verwendet werden. Die erforderlichen Dateien sind:

  • CustomizationsSolution.xsd

  • fetch.xsd

  • FormXml.xsd

  • isv.config.xsd

  • RibbonCore.xsd

  • RibbonTypes.xsd

  • RibbonWSS.xsd

  • SiteMap.xsd

  • SiteMapType.xsd

  • VisualizationDataDescription.xsd

    Diese Dateien werden auch auf dem lokalen Dynamics 365 for Customer Engagement Server installiert: [Install Drive]\Program Files\Microsoft Dynamics CRM\Server\ApplicationFiles

  CustomizationsSolution.xsd ist das Schema für die exportierte Lösung. Es enthält Verweise auf andere XSD-Dateien. Alle Dateien müssen sich im selben Ordner befinden.

Verwenden von Schemaüberprüfung

Da es sich bei der exportierten XML-Datei um eine Textdatei handelt, können Sie sie mit einem Texteditor wie z.B. Notepad bearbeiten. Es wird jedoch unbedingt empfohlen, dass Sie eine Anwendung verwenden, die die Überprüfung von XSD-Schemas unterstützt, wie z. B. Visual Studio. Die XSD-Validierung in Visual Studio oder Visual Studio Express 2012 for Web bietet IntelliSense-Informationen und Schema-Validierung, um Fehler zu vermeiden.

Die XCD-Schemadateien, die verwendet werden, um die Datei customizations.xml in einer Lösung zu validieren, stehen unter zur Verfügung. Downloaden Sie die Schemas. Stellen Sie sicher, dass Sie alle Dateien aus diesem Ordner in dasselbe Verzeichnis kopieren. Sie müssen die Datei customizations.xml mit der Datei CustomizationsSolution.xsd verknüpfen. Diese Datei enthält Verweise auf alle anderen XSD-Dateien im Ordner.

  1. Laden Sie die XSD-Schemadateien herunter und kopieren Sie alle auf Ihren Computer. Speichern Sie diese an dem Ort, den Visual Studio für XSD-Überprüfungsdateien verwendet. Dieser Speicherort ist wahrscheinlich [install drive]\Program Files (x86)\Microsoft Visual Studio X.0\Xml\Schemas, wobei X auf die Visual Studio-Version verweist.

  2. Klicken Sie mit der rechten Maustaste auf die Datei customizations.xml; wählen Sie Öffnen mit, und wählen Sie dann die Version von Visual Studio aus.

  3. Wählen Sie Ansicht und anschließend Eigenschaftenfenster aus.

  4. Klicken Sie im Fenster Eigenschaften im Feld Schemas auf die Schaltfläche mit den Auslassungszeichen [...].

  5. Im Dialogfeld Xml-Schemas sollte die Datei customizationsSolution.xsd angezeigt werden. Wählen Sie in der Spalte Verwenden die Option Dieses Schema verwenden aus.

    Notiz

    Wenn sie es nicht finden können, klicken Sie auf Hinzufügen und navigieren Sie zu dem Speicherort, an dem Sie es gespeichert haben.

  6. Klicken Sie auf OK.

    Nun können damit beginnen, die XML-Datei mit XSD-Überprüfung zu bearbeiten.

Siehe auch

Wann müssen Sie die Anpassungsdatei für Dynamics 365 Customer Engagement bearbeiten
Menüband KernschemaMenüband Typen SchemaMenüband WSS SchemaSiteMap Schema
Formular-XML-Schema
ISV-Konfigurationsdateischema
Abfragen erstellen mit FetchXML